2018/03/06 23:50:15
FoxyCapri
No big deal there, the number 14 in the CK14KL Prefix code tells you it's a Capri Deluxe and after all, Capri's, Cortina's and Escort's were all coming down the same assembly line together back in the day at Homebush.
